The classic Japanese racing rim of the 60's in the Watanabe, the 8 spoke wheel that comes in various colours (black is the classic colour) and is EXTEMELY light.

Anyway, they're also very expensive. New they cost around 200$ per wheel, then you have to pay shipping.

My dad recently asked me what wheels I'm going to buy for my Ken&Mary 240K, and when I told him they would be black, he was disgusted! He doesn't like black wheels... A few of my friends have also asked why the hell I would want black wheels. I think they're great looking, and they are THE wheel to have if you own a classic Japanese car.

Anyway, I just wondered what you guys thought... here are some pics to let you know what the "black bananas" wheel looks like.
